NIH funds cross-campus effort to train experts in AI and nutrition
September 11, 2023
ITHACA, New York, Sept. 11 -- Cornell University issued the following news:

Cornell has received a $1.7 million grant from the National Institutes of Health (NIH) to develop a program that combines precision nutrition with advanced data science and analytical methods, equipping students to address complex health challenges like nutrition disparities and diet-related chronic diseases.
